diff -r 0b0e9fce0b58 -r 4ccf8e394726 datacommsserver/esockserver/inc/ss_nodemessages.h --- a/datacommsserver/esockserver/inc/ss_nodemessages.h Wed Mar 31 23:27:09 2010 +0300 +++ b/datacommsserver/esockserver/inc/ss_nodemessages.h Wed Apr 14 17:14:05 2010 +0300 @@ -115,6 +115,23 @@ EXPORT_DATA_VTABLE_AND_FN }; +class TTierTypeIdFactoryQuery : public TFactoryQueryBase + { +public: + IMPORT_C TTierTypeIdFactoryQuery(); + + IMPORT_C explicit TTierTypeIdFactoryQuery(const TUid aTierTypeId); + +protected: + IMPORT_C virtual Factories::MFactoryQuery::TMatchResult Match(Factories::TFactoryObjectInfo& aFactoryObjectInfo); + +public: + TUid iTierTypeId; + + DECLARE_MVIP_CTR(TTierTypeIdFactoryQuery) + EXPORT_DATA_VTABLE_AND_FN + }; + class TDefaultConnectionFactoryQuery : public TFactoryQueryBase /** Class implementing MFactoryQuery to find a connection provider.